    Subject: Re: HS skin fit
    --> RV9-List message posted by: Paul Eastham <abstraction@yahoo.com> Regarding the tight-fitting HS skin... Dennis guessed right, here is a reply from Van's for the record: The skeleton is a pretty tight fit in the skin, you will need to remove the vinyl from the skin and the spars to get the holes to line up. In addition, it may be necessary to adjust the rib profile very slightly, especially around the front to get the holes lined up. Using some light grease on the ribs can also help the skin slide across them more easily, and avoid scratching the skin. <snip> Sure wish they had put that in the manual. It clearly says it is ok to leave the skin on during drilling. __________________________________
